## Service Accounts — StormFan Alert Fan-Out

The fan-out worker authenticates to the internal dispatch tier using the svc-stormfan account. Rotate quarterly; scopes are limited to publish-only on alert topics. If deliveries stall during your shift, verify the worker is using the current credential, reproduced below for reference.

API key for kaweg-hahif: kto4_rAjZ

## Authentication — RotoVault CLI

Heads up for release: RotoVault needs a bearer credential before it'll touch any secret store. The CLI reads it from the ROTOVAULT_TOKEN env var; no flag, no config file — that's deliberate, so tokens never land in shell history or dotfiles.

Tokens are scoped per environment and expire weekly, so mint a fresh one before each release cut. For the current release-staging environment, export the token below.

login token, bagug-kafop: eyJhbGciOiJIUzI1NiIsInR5cCI6IkpXVCJ9.eyJzdWIiOiIcMLov2In0.Z5RLDIfp

- [ ] Step 7: Archive cold storage buckets (Glacierline tier). Confirm both ceremony witnesses are present, verify bucket manifests match the Oxbow ledger, then seal the archive key shares. Plugin authors may observe but not handle shares. Once sealed, the archive index itself is encrypted and can only be reopened with the passphrase below.

vault phrase of badup-hahig = tamael-aldael-kelmir-istael-fenok-istwyn-tamius-jorath-oliion

[ ] Key ceremony step 7 — Resizely CLI signing key

Hey on-call: before you re-sign the Resizely batch image-resizing CLI (v2.4), double-check that the old key is revoked in the Fenwick registry — we had a near-miss last quarter where both keys were live. Run the dry-run resize against the sample bucket first so we know the binary isn't corrupted. Once the HSM prompts you during the signing step, enter the ceremony recovery passphrase below.

unlock words, yawig-kagef: gordor-holvan-ulaael-pramir-ulaiel-tamdor